HTML, BODY {
	background: #C7BEA1 url(kuvat/bg_site_tile.jpg) 0 0 repeat-x;
	margin: 0;
	padding: 0;
	font-family: 'Trebuchet Ms',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-align: center;
}
DIV, UL, LI, P, H1, H2, IMG, TABLE {
	margin: 0;
	padding: 0;
}
DIV#wrap {
	width: 700px;
	background: #FFF;
	margin: auto;
	text-align: left;
	color: #6A5142;
}
DIV#header {
	position: relative;
	width: 700px;
	height: 112px;
	background: transparent url(kuvat/header.jpg) 0 0 no-repeat;
}
A#homelink {
	display: block;
	position: absolute;
	left: 6px;
	top: 26px;
	width: 170px;
	height: 83px;
	text-indent: -9999px;
	text-decoration: none;
}
A#kauppalink {
	display: block;
	position: absolute;
	left: 500px;
	top: 26px;
	width: 170px;
	height: 83px;
	text-indent: -9999px;
	text-decoration: none;
}


DIV#menu-isokuva {
	width: 700px;
	height: 234px;
	background: transparent url(kuvat/menu_isokuva_index.jpg) 0 0 no-repeat;
}
UL#mainmenu {
	position: relative;
	width: 171px;
	height: 220px;
	background: transparent url(kuvat/menu_main.jpg) 0 110px no-repeat;
	margin: 0 0 0 5px;
	list-style: none;
}
UL#mainmenu LI {
	position: absolute;
	left: 0;
	width: 171px;
	height: 17px;
}
UL#mainmenu LI A {
	display: block;
	width: 171px;
	height: 17px;
	text-decoration: none;
	text-indent: -9999px;
}

UL#mainmenu LI#lampaat { top: 110px; }
UL#mainmenu LI#tontut { top: 128px; }
UL#mainmenu LI#aitat { top: 146px; }
UL#mainmenu LI#nayttelyita { top: 164px; }
UL#mainmenu LI#tonttupaja { top: 182px; }
UL#mainmenu LI#palautelomake { top: 200px; }

UL#mainmenu LI#lampaat A:HOVER { background: transparent url(kuvat/menu_main.jpg) 0 -110px no-repeat; }
UL#mainmenu LI#tontut A:HOVER { background: transparent url(kuvat/menu_main.jpg) 0 -128px no-repeat; }
UL#mainmenu LI#aitat A:HOVER { background: transparent url(kuvat/menu_main.jpg) 0 -146px no-repeat; }
UL#mainmenu LI#nayttelyita A:HOVER { background: transparent url(kuvat/menu_main.jpg) 0 -164px no-repeat; }
UL#mainmenu LI#tonttupaja A:HOVER { background: transparent url(kuvat/menu_main.jpg) 0 -182px no-repeat; }
UL#mainmenu LI#palautelomake A:HOVER { background: transparent url(kuvat/menu_main.jpg) 0 -200px no-repeat; }

DIV#content {
	width: 700px;
	background: #FFFCF4 url(kuvat/content_leftpic_brown.jpg) 0 0 no-repeat;
}
DIV#content-text {
	margin: 0 0 0 176px;
}
H1 {
	height: 44px;
	margin: 0 0 0 22px;
	font-size: 1px;
	text-indent: -9999px;
}
H1#h1-index { background: transparent url(kuvat/h1_index.jpg) 0 11px no-repeat; }
H1#h1-lamp { background: transparent url(kuvat/h1_lampaat.jpg) 0 11px no-repeat; }
H1#h1-tont { background: transparent url(kuvat/h1_tontut.jpg) 0 11px no-repeat; }
H1#h1-aita { background: transparent url(kuvat/h1_aitat.jpg) 0 11px no-repeat; }
H1#h1-nayt { background: transparent url(kuvat/h1_nayttelyt.jpg) 0 11px no-repeat; }
H1#h1-paja { background: transparent url(kuvat/h1_tonttupaja.jpg) 0 11px no-repeat; }
H1#h1-pala { background: transparent url(kuvat/h1_palaute.jpg) 0 11px no-repeat; }

TABLE#palstat {
	width: 501px;
	border-collapse: collapse;
	margin: 0 23px 0 0;
	padding: 0;
}
TABLE#palstat TD {
	width: 50%;
	padding: 0 0 0 23px;
	vertical-align: top;
}
TABLE#palstat TD P {
	margin: 0 0 12px 0;
}
TABLE#tuotekuvat {
	border-collapse: collapse;
	margin: 40px 0 6px 0;
}
TABLE#tuotekuvat TD {
	margin: 0;
	padding: 0;
	vertical-align: top;
}
TABLE#tuotekuvat TD IMG {
	margin: 0 0 0 6px;
}
DIV#footer {
	width: 700px;
	height: 23px;
	background: transparent url(kuvat/footer.jpg) 0 0 no-repeat;
	clear: both;
}

FORM {
	margin: 0;
	padding: 0;
	line-height: 22px;
}
INPUT, TEXTAREA {
	border: 1px solid #A9A28D;
	margin: 0;
	padding: 1px 2px 1px 2px;
	font-family: 'Trebuchet Ms', Arial, Helvetica, sans-serif;
	font-size: 11px;
}
INPUT.radio {
	border: 0;
	margin: 0 3px -3px 0;
}
.topmargin {
	margin: 10px 0 0 0;
}
